Ochiltree County, TX: what topping up your attic actually costs
Ochiltree County sits in IECC climate zone 4 (Mixed-Dry) — big seasonal swings - a dry hot summer, then a real winter cold snap. For a currently uninsulated attic, DOE and ENERGY STAR recommend building up to R-60. Topping up a typical 1,000-square-foot attic from bare joists (R-2) to R-60 runs an estimated $3,480, and saves about $1,355 a year in heating and cooling — a payback around 2.6 years. That's about as fast as attic paybacks get.

Ochiltree County's actual weather, not a national average
The heating and cooling degree days behind this estimate — 3,957 HDD and 1,848 CDD (base 65°F, 1991-2020 normals) — come from PERRYTON, TX US, the nearest NOAA station with published normals, 7.7 miles from Ochiltree County's center. Combined heating and cooling load puts Ochiltree County in the 47th percentile of this 3,162-county dataset. Ochiltree County falls in DOE's moisture regime B (dry), a detail that affects vapor-barrier recommendations more than the R-value target itself.
The smaller top-up scenario
If Ochiltree County's attic already has 3-4 inches of old insulation (about R-11) rather than bare joists, the recommended target drops to R-49. That smaller top-up costs around $2,280 and saves an estimated $198/year — payback about 11.5 years. This one is a genuine toss-up, not a clear yes.
